Common Myths About Refractive Lens Exchange



When it pertains to refractive lens exchange (RLE), many people hold onto false impressions that can shadow their understanding of the treatment.

One common myth is that RLE is just for older adults, but it can benefit younger people with severe refractive mistakes.

One more mistaken belief is that RLE is similar to cataract surgical treatment, but both procedures have different goals and techniques.

Some people fret about the recovery time, thinking it'll take weeks, when most people return to regular activities within a few days.

You may also hear that RLE is too risky, however modern-day innovations have actually made it a safe option for many.

Understanding the RLE Treatment



Refractive lens exchange (RLE) includes a series of exact actions made to boost your vision.

Initially, your eye doctor will certainly conduct a comprehensive exam to analyze your eye health and wellness and figure out if you're an appropriate candidate.

As soon as authorized, you'll get an anesthetic to ensure convenience throughout the procedure.

Your surgeon will make a small laceration in your cornea, enabling access to the over cast lens. They'll carefully remove it and replace it with a customized man-made lens tailored to your specific vision needs.
